Sean Michael Duffy, 52, born Dec. 23, 1968 died Feb 16, 2021.
Sean was born in Putnam, Ct. to Michael Duffy and Sandra Murdock.
After graduating from Putnam High School, he attended Lake City Community College earning his degree in Turf Grass Management. While attending college he was employed at Gainesville Golf & Country Club. In 1993 Sean married his high school sweetheart, Jennifer Desautels Duffy. They moved to Central Florida where they both were employed at Grand Cypress Resort. He then went on to build and manage the Golf Course operations at Keene’s Pointe of Orlando. In 2004 the family moved to Naples where Sean was the Golf Course Superintendent at Twin Eagles Country Club. For the last 12 years Sean was the Golf Course Superintendent and Director of Golf Course Operations at one of Central Florida's premier facilities, Isleworth Golf & Country Club.
Sean was a dedicated professional and family man. He was an avid Gator fan and loyal to his roots-The Boston Red Sox & New England Patriots.
In addition Sean is survived by his wife Jennifer, children Tyler Michael (23) and Casey Jane (21), his Mother- Sandra Murdock Perkins, Step-mother- Donna Duffy, brother- Conor Duffy and wife Valerie. He is preceded in death by his father Michael Duffy.
Sean’s local family includes his in-laws Judy & Jerry Desautels, Sister-in-law Jane & Giuseppe Magliocchetti and their children- Francesca, Luciano and Giovanni.
